What Is a Serum? 

“Serums are usually formulated with a higher concentration of active ingredients so that a few drops are sufficient to cover the entire face,” says Dr. Geyer. “By using a serum, people can intensify the strength of their regimen or round out the ingredients they are applying to their skin to provide a more comprehensive approach to anti-aging and hydration.” As Dr. Geyer explains, serums are usually lighter in texture than moisturizers. Because of this, they can be used on their own if you have oily skin or underneath a moisturizer if you have normal to dry skin. 

When Should You Apply a Serum? 

Serums should be applied twice daily. “They are the first products that should be applied to the skin after cleansing and toning,” explains Geyer. According to Geyer, you should apply sunscreen after the serum in the morning. You’ll also want to follow up your serum with moisturizer in the morning and evening. He advises that you apply the serum with one or two fingers, so that you don’t waste any of the product on your hands. 

The Best Serums to Try 

Now that you’ve got the basics and application covered, which serum should you choose? Well, the answer depends on your skin goals. “There are many different types of serums and both the active ingredients and the texture can provide different functions and benefits,” notes Geyer. “Serums formulated in a water base, for example, tend to be well-suited for those with oily skin, and those with a richer texture, or formulated with oils, tend to work well for those with drier skin. However, it’s really the combination of active ingredients that define the serum.”
